Weather Forecast for Tomorrow in the UAE

The National Center of Meteorology expects tomorrow's weather to be partly cloudy and dusty at times, especially in the east and north during the day with a further rise in temperatures. It will become humid at night and Monday morning in some coastal areas with the possibility of fog or light fog
